A Science and an Art

This guide takes a strategic look at student recruitment by starting with what types of students your schools serves best and your school’s enrollment priorities.

This guide is part of a series covering advancement at independent schools.  Written by professionals at independent schools, the guides are right on target for small advancement operations with ambitious goals and limited resources. 

Developed in partnership with the National Association of Independent Schools.

About the Author

Kathleen A. Hanson

Kathleen A. Hanson is the assistant head/vice president for advancement and external affairs at the Baylor School, a day and boarding school of 1,000 students in Chattanooga, Tenn. She is the former director of institutional advancement at the Fessenden School in West Newton, Mass., and Kent Place School in Summit, N.J. A frequent speaker and workshop trainer on advancement issues, Hanson serves as consultant for many National Association of Independent Schools (NAIS) member schools on marketing, management and fundraising. She served as chair of the CASE/NAIS 2005 conference and contributed a chapter on market research to Marketing Independent Schools in the 21st Century (NAIS, 2001).
